Mechanical Engineer - Sustainable Design & Build

Location: Centennial, CO (Hybrid)

Compensation: $90,000-$140,000 + Bonus + Benefits


About the Opportunity

A design-build firm focused on sustainability is seeking a Mechanical Engineer to support energy-efficient commercial building projects. This role is ideal for someone passionate about reducing environmental impact through smart HVAC and MEP engineering.


What You'll Do

You'll take ownership of HVAC and MEP design for LEED-oriented and decarbonization-driven projects, working closely with architects, contractors, and sustainability consultants to deliver performance-focused solutions from concept through construction.


Key Responsibilities

  • Design mechanical systems with an emphasis on energy efficiency and sustainability
  • Produce detailed MEP documentation and Revit models
  • Perform load calculations, equipment selection, and system layout
  • Collaborate across disciplines to support integrated project delivery
  • Handle construction administration tasks (e.g., RFIs, submittals)


What We're Looking For

  • B.S. in Mechanical Engineering
  • Demonstrated experience in HVAC/MEP design
  • Proficiency in Revit or AutoCAD
  • Strong grasp of mechanical codes, systems, and sustainable design principles
  • Effective communication and collaboration skills


Preferred Qualifications

  • Familiarity with energy modeling software (Trace 700, OpenStudio, eQuest)
  • Experience with LEED, WELL, or similar green building frameworks
